Foreign and Trade reaffirm the Government's objective of reinforcing the Spanish presence in Africa


The meeting was opened by Arancha González Laya, who pointed out that "Africa is a priority for the Government of Spain. We want to translate the African priority into concrete actions, in a joint effort by the Ministries of Foreign Affairs and Trade to build long-term opportunities for Spanish companies and for the economic growth of the continent. The launch of the African Free Trade Area, the largest on the planet, and the next EU-Africa summit, offer opportunities that we want to work on. "

Reyes Maroto presented the main lines of "Horizon Africa", a commercial and financial strategy to support the internationalization of Spanish companies in the African market and favor a growing and solid Spanish presence on the continent: "The strategy includes measures of public support with two axes, institutional and financial, through which we want to contribute to increasing and reinforcing the competitiveness of exports and investments ".

The meeting allowed working on institutional presence, financing instruments, mobility and legal security instruments on the continent. Representatives from TSK, AEE Power, Caixabank, FCC Aqualiad, Consultrans, Acciona, Abengoa, Indra and Rufepa participated in the meeting.
